Cultural Resources Management

Cultural Resources Management: GECO personnel have extensive experience completing cultural resource management (CRM) projects in a timely and responsive manner on military lands and DMA properties in particular.  Our unique experience with DMA cultural resources and familiarity with the NHPA and SHPO regulatory process helps our clients attain a cost effective and timely solution to their cultural resource goals.  In addition, GECO maintains a good working relationship with Gray & Pape, Inc., a well respected firm specializing in cultural resource management and historic preservation services.  In conjunction with their Richmond, VA office, GECO is equipped to provide CRM services including:
•    Phase I Archeological & Architectural Surveys
•    Phase II  Native American and Historic Period Archeological Site Excavations
•    Phase III Archeological Data Recovery Plans and Excavations
•    Cultural Resource Management Plans
•    Native American Tribal Coordination
•    National Register nominations
•    Prehistoric/Historic Artifact Analysis and Inventory Databases
•    Historic Documents Research (e.g., deeds, will books, maps)
•    Public Outreach
•    VDHR Coordination
